Output eca31e969c6aec688dadf301e0cb04df62a93b20c1c7dffd84f7bbcffdae60bf:0

value
1500408152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d531539be42db82abd5860b0359fdd4ed4c52e61 OP_EQUAL
address
MTLRFZZJYfu43L1NjmRMX9rQYCpgRZeuSD
transaction
eca31e969c6aec688dadf301e0cb04df62a93b20c1c7dffd84f7bbcffdae60bf
spent
true